Understanding the Types of Perforated Sheet Metal
Perforated sheet metal is an incredibly versatile product used in various industries, including construction, manufacturing, and design. By definition, perforated sheet metal is a flat sheet that has been punched with a series of holes to create a specific pattern, allowing for air, light, and sound to pass through while maintaining structural integrity. This article will delve into the different types of perforated sheet metal, highlighting their features, benefits, and common applications.
1. Materials Used in Perforated Sheet Metal
The first step in understanding perforated sheet metal is recognizing the materials from which it is made. Common materials include
- Stainless Steel Known for its corrosion resistance and durability, stainless steel perforated sheets are widely used in food processing, medical applications, and architecture. - Aluminum Lightweight and resistant to corrosion, aluminum is favored in applications like ventilation systems and decorative facades. - Galvanized Steel This material is coated with a layer of zinc to prevent rusting. Galvanized perforated sheets are prevalent in outdoor applications. - Copper and Brass While more costly, these materials are often used for aesthetic purposes, providing a unique look in architectural designs.
Each material brings unique benefits and is selected based on the intended application and environment.
2. Types of Perforated Patterns
Perforated sheets can be crafted in various hole sizes and patterns, which significantly influence their utility and aesthetic appeal
. Some popular patterns include- Round Holes The most common perforation type, round holes are often used in industrial applications where consistent airflow is required. - Square Holes These offer a modern aesthetic and are typically used in applications like speaker grills and decorative panels, allowing for optimal sound passage. - Slot Holes Elongated slots offer unique ventilation properties and are often found in filters and ventilation ducts. - Custom Shapes Depending on the application, sheets can be perforated with custom shapes such as triangles, hexagons, or even complex designs for artistic purposes.
3. Key Benefits of Perforated Sheet Metal
The use of perforated sheet metal provides numerous advantages
- Ventilation With holes allowing air circulation, they are perfect for applications requiring airflow, such as in radiators, HVAC systems, and cooling units. - Light Permeability In lighting design, perforated sheets can diffuse light effectively, creating visually appealing and functional products. - Weight Reduction Perforation reduces the weight of the sheets without compromising strength, making them suitable for projects where weight is a concern. - Aesthetic Appeal The variety of patterns and finishes available allows designers to incorporate perforated sheets in a way that enhances the visual appeal of structures and products.
4. Applications of Perforated Sheet Metal
Perforated sheet metal finds applications across a myriad of industries
- Architecture and Design Used in facades, interior partitions, and sunshades, perforated sheets allow for artistic creativity while ensuring functional benefits. - Industrial Commonly employed in filters, sieves, and conveyor systems, they play a crucial role in manufacturing processes. - Automotive Perforated sheets are utilized in acoustic panels and heat shields to enhance performance and reduce noise. - Furniture Designers use perforated metals in furniture pieces for both aesthetics and practicality, adding a modern touch and ensuring ventilation.
